The hexadecimal color code #CE8B3F corresponds to the code RGB( 206, 139, 63 ). It's a shade of Orange. This color is a combination of red (at 0,81 level), green (at 0,55 level) and blue (at 0,25 level). Its brightness is 52% and its saturation is 59%. It is composed of red at 50%, green at 34% and blue at 15%.
